A staff of Toronto attorneys seized on the Canada connection, submitting civil lawsuits that argue that the Canadian parent company, later acquired by Hudbay, was negligent when it got here to monitoring the actions of its Guatemalan subsidiary. The case centres on allegations courting back to 2007, when the women say lots of of police, army and and private safety personnel linked to a Canadian mining company descended on the secluded village of Lote Ocho in eastern Guatemala.

The first targeted on a lately launched report from the Commission for Historical Clarification (CEH), a U.N.-supported truth commission tasked with investigating the occasions of greater than three decades of warfare, from 1960 to 1996. After nearly a year of investigation that included interviews with eleven,000 folks, the impartial commission concluded that navy and paramilitary groups had been answerable for ninety three % of the more than 200,000 warfare-associated deaths.

The women’s lawsuit is one of three the community has filed against Hudbay in Ontario. The other two link the corporate to the 2009 death of a neighborhood activist, Adolfo Ich Chamán, in addition to a capturing that left a 28-yr-old man paralysed. The novel method scored its first victory in 2013, when a court docket in Ontario dismissed an software by Hudbay to throw out the case. The determination marked the primary time in Canada that foreign claimants had been granted access to the courts in order to pursue Canadian firms for alleged human rights abuses overseas.

The seek for disappeared relatives has been some of the anguishing experiences that resulted from the political repression in Guatemala. It is a wrestle that was significantly initiated and led by women. The emergency state of affairs induced many ladies to take leading public roles in their communities and in society in general, as they moved into actions that had been historically denied them. Acts of violence in opposition to women are described within the testimonies gathered by the REMHI, but very few references are made to the actual experiences of women who suffered such abuse.

rade liberalization pushed by the World Bank’s 1980s structural adjustment policies had lowered obstacles to imports from the U.S. As corn from the U.S. flowed into Guatemala, it diminished the worth of locally grown crops, forcing countless rural farmers into debt or monetary damage. Maya-Mam Guatemalans I lived among noticed the enlargement of free trade as an economic extension of the genocide waged in opposition to them.
